WebOct 10, 2024 · CALs do not typically expire. Products reach end of life/support. I believe SQL 08 is already past EOS. However typically if you buy licenses for software piece X you have authorization to use it. Even if it is no longer receiving updates. WebJan 20, 2024 · The price is for as long as the customer wants to use it, perpetual software licenses don't expire like software subscriptions would do. So it only one time €31. Of course, if they want then in a few year RDS on Windows Server 2026 (Hypothetical name!), they would need to buy new RDS CALs for this version. WebAug 13, 2015 · 1. RDS User CAL's (Assuming its per user CAL's) expire after about 60 days of not being used which means they go back into your 'unused CAL pool'. Device CAL's are about 90 days if memory serves me correct. However, this is only the case if you are licensing the machine against a licensing server. If no license server has …
